Fix issue 41928 (#48295)

Details:

The issue was that verify_heap called copy_brick_card_table while another thread was growing these tables, so we ended up with a mark_array where the sections for a new segment were not committed, leading to an AV in bgc_verify_mark_array_cleared.

The fix is to take the gc_lock *before* calling veriy_heap. To avoid a deadlock, the lock has to be taken before we suspend the EE. This only affects the end of a background GC, the verify_heap at the start of a background GC already happens under the gc_lock.

I factored out common code into new methods enter_gc_lock_for_verify_heap and leave_gc_lock_for_verify_heap.

void gc_heap::enter_gc_lock_for_verify_heap()
{
#ifdef VERIFY_HEAP
if (GCConfig::GetHeapVerifyLevel() & GCConfig::HEAPVERIFY_GC)
{
enter_spin_lock (&gc_heap::gc_lock);
dprintf (SPINLOCK_LOG, ("enter gc_lock for verify_heap"));
}
#endif // VERIFY_HEAP
}
void gc_heap::leave_gc_lock_for_verify_heap()
{
#ifdef VERIFY_HEAP
if (GCConfig::GetHeapVerifyLevel() & GCConfig::HEAPVERIFY_GC)
{
dprintf (SPINLOCK_LOG, ("leave gc_lock taken for verify_heap"));
leave_spin_lock (&gc_heap::gc_lock);
}
#endif // VERIFY_HEAP
}
